> For gocryptfs and its friends golang-github-jacobsa-crypto and
> golang-github-rfjakob-eme we keep upstream's branch in 'master', which
> mirrors their 'master' branches on GitHub. I did not set it up that
> way but find the naming super convenient. It mirrors my work in Git
> repos whenever I contribute upstream (which I do with great
> frequency). I keep all feature branches (in this case 'debian/sid')
> separate from the authoritative upstream source, and never have to
> think twice before issuing 'git merge master'.
